Maxon’s New ESCON 36/2 – A Powerful PWM Servo Controller
Maxon’s new ESCON 36/2 DC is a 4-quadrant PWM servo controller for use with DC motors up to 72 Watt. This very fast digital current controller, with enormous bandwidth for optimal motor current/torque control, provides drift-free yet extremely dynamic speed behavior through a speed range of 1 to 150,000 rpm. |
Parker releases I31 EtherCAT fieldbus option
The high-performance motion-bus networkis now installed in Compax3 servo drives. Parker’s Electromechanical Automation Division, a leading supplier of motion controltechnology, is pleased to announce the release of its EtherCAT fieldbusoption. EtherCAT is an open, real-time, high-speedmotion-bus network that operates over fast Ethernet at 100 Mbit. It isa fast-growing industrial network and, similar to other Ethernet-basedmotion-bus networks, it offers speeds that are faster than DeviceNet, ModbusTCPand Profibus. |

AMC’s 25A8 Servo Amplifier Features 1kW Output
Servo2Go.com announces the release of the 25A8 servo amplifier from Advanced Motion Controls of Camarillo, CA, designed to conquer the most demanding of applications! The 25A8 PWM servo amplifier is designed to drive brush type DC & PMDC motors with & without tachometer feedback. Power MOSFETS and surface mount technology deliver up to 99% efficiency with switching frequency to 22 kHz. User simply provides an unregulated DC input voltage plus analog command signal (up to +-15V, 50K input resistance) and operation is immediate. No set-up or tuning software required. The 25A8 is fully protected against over-voltage, over-current, over-heating and short circuits across motor, ground and power leads. |
